Proceeding contribution from Lord Dodds of Duncairn (Democratic Unionist Party) in the House of Commons on Thursday, 15 October 2009. It occurred during Debate on Defence Policy.


Defence Policy

I thank the Secretary of State for giving way so often. On the issue of the Territorial Army and the freeze on training, I should say that more than 1,000 members of the Territorial Army from Northern Ireland are on operational deployment, which is a very high proportion, and there is real concern about what will happen to preparation for Afghanistan over the next six months. Is he saying that anyone going to Afghanistan will be trained and paid? We need to have clarification about that, because there is great concern.
